Americus-Sumter Fuller Center for Housing Building a Better World, One House at a Time! It is a HAND UP NOT A HAND OUT.

Qualifing applicants are chosen based on need, a favorable credit report, ability for family, friends and others to donate their time to join volunteers with the construction. Americus-Sumter Fuller Center for Housing was founded in 2007 and the inaugural project was a Greater Blessing renovation to a home that had been damaged by the 2007 tornado. Since then the Americus-Sumter Fuller Center has

been proudly partnering with volunteers, donors, and other organizations in an effort to provide adequate shelter for families in Sumter County.

Since the first Fuller Center for Housing walls were raised on a new home in Shreveport, Louisiana, back in 2005, our affordable housing ministry has built or repaired 9,999 homes.

On Saturday, March 21, 2026, we will dedicate milestone home No. 10,000 as volunteers and supporters come together in Fitzgerald, Georgia, to bless a new home for the Spivey family.

The 10,000 homes does not include certain special efforts like yard cleanups and such — only projects that either built new homes or helped families stay safely and comfortable in the existing homes they love. Those include projects such as roof replacements, refitting homes to make them accessible for wheelchairs and more.

We remain committed to the grass-roots, Christian principles upon which we were founded in 2005 — principles whose roots go all the way back to the 1960s at Georgia’s historic Koinonia Farm, where our founder Millard Fuller (pictured in Shreveport in 2005) developed the concept of partnership housing under the tutelage of his mentor, theologian Clarence Jordan.

This work would not be possible without our loyal financial supporters, dedicated volunteers, church partners and the thousands of others who believe that everyone deserves to have a simple, decent place to call home.

Recently, young men and ladies visited ASFC from Wittenberg University, Springfiled, OH. (www.wittenberg.edu)They spent part of their spring break working and giving of themselves to help make a home safer and sound for one of our clients. She now has a new roof that will last for years. They also built frames for windows and doors that will be used in the "BIG EVENT" to build a house for a client during the blitz build in April. Beginning April 8 Gerogia Southwestern State University, the Carter Presidential Leadership scholars and the Fuller Center for Housing will build a new home located in Americus in honor of Rosaylann and Jimmy Carter. The dedication of the home is scheduled for April 19.
